During a ceremony organized by Cairo Chamber of Commerce, and in the presence of Dr. Nevin Al-Kabbaj, Minister of Social Solidarity, and Eng. Ibrahim El-Araby, Chairman of the General Federation of Egyptian Chambers of Commerce (FEDCOC) and Chairman of Cairo Chamber of Commerce ( CCC), the Ministry of Social Solidarity, through “Nasser Bank” and the General Federation of Chambers of Commerce, signed a protocol of joint cooperation to support Chambers of Commerce members all over the Republic with financing and non-financing services provided by the Bank.

 

 

The meeting was attended by Dr. Mervat Sabreen, Assistant Minister for Social Protection and Economic Empowerment and Chairman of the Board of Directors of Nasser Social Bank, Mohamed Ashmawy, Vice Chairman of NSB, Ahmed El-Weisimy, Vice Chairman of CCC, and Eng. Sameh Zaky, Vice Chairman of CCC.

 

 

The cooperation protocol aims to support and develop medium, small and micro enterprises that provide job opportunities and achieve sustainable development by providing integrated economic links from supply and distribution chains, maximizing output, reducing factory waste and recycling, in addition to developing villages in need within the framework of "a decent life "initiative that launched  by President Abdel Fattah El-Sisi.

 

 

This comes at a time when the "projects of Egyptian Origin" initiative was launched in partnership between the Ministry of Social Solidarity and CCC through Division of Professional Hair Salon headed by Mahmoud El-Degwy, and this initiative aims to support the hairdresser profession and rehabilitate its workers to find job opportunities and provide them a decent life.
